Delphi Material erste Schritte Variablen Typen Datenstruktur Zuweisung Komponenten StyleGuide Kontrollstrukturen Fehler Debuggen Funktionen Prozeduren Grafik Ereignisse Programme Unit OOP Benutzung einer Klasse Projektverwaltung Muster Format String-Operationen Datei Dialoge Menü Datenbank WinAPI Zufallszahlen RE Exceptions alte Delphiseite
Pfad: Startseite / Fächer / Informatik / Delphi / Funktionen
Autor: mk
28.10.2005 15:49:50
4190
Funktionen

Ein einfaches Programm zum Berechnen von Wertetabellen

GUI zu Wertetabelle 0 wertetabelle.zip

procedure TForm1.bRechneClick(Sender: TObject);
const
  xa = -3;  // linke Grenze
  xe = +3;  // rechte Grenze
  dx = 0.5; // Schrittweite
var
  x,y : real;

  function f(x : real) : real;  // Funktionsvereinbarung
  begin
    result := x*x;
  end;

begin
  mAusgabe.Lines.Add('x'+#9+'y');     // #9 Tabulator 
  mAusgabe.Lines.Add('----------------------------');

  x := xa;
  while x <= xe do
  begin
    y := f(x);                  // Funktionsaufruf
    mAusgabe.Lines.Add(FloatToStr(x)+#9+FloatToStr(y));
    x := x+dx;
  end;
end;